There are 5 ways to get from Berlin to Piła by train, bus, or car
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Train
best- Take the train from S Ostbahnhof to Rzepin95 / ...
- Take the train from Rzepin to Poznan Glowny95 / ...
- Take the train from Poznan Glowny to Pila GlownaIc / ...
4h 59mzł 224–489Bus, train
cheapest- Take the bus from Berlin Alexanderplatz to Szczecin, Bus Station157 / ...
- Take the train from Szczecin Glowny to Pila GlownaR
5h 57mzł 85–174Bus via Szczecin
- Take the bus from Berlin Alexanderplatz to Szczecin, Bus Station157 / ...
- Take the bus from Szczecin, Bus Station to Pila, Centrum Przesiadkowe1352
6h 15mzł 120–194Drive 256.5 km
- Drive from Berlin to Piła256.5 km
4h 2mzł 152–219Bus
- Take the bus from BERLIN, ZOB am Funkturm to SŁUBICE, Port Świecko, Świecko 39
- Take the bus from SŁUBICE, Port Świecko, Świecko 39 to PIŁA, Centrum Przesiadkowe, ul. Zygmunta Starego,stan.9
7h 31mzł 470–597
Berlin to Piła by train
Questions & Answers
The cheapest way to get from Berlin to Piła is to bus and train which costs 85 zł - 180 zł and takes 5h 57m.
The fastest way to get from Berlin to Piła is to drive which takes 4h 2m and costs 150 zł - 220 zł.
No, there is no direct bus from Berlin to Piła. However, there are services departing from Berlin Alexanderplatz and arriving at Pila, Centrum Przesiadkowe via Szczecin, Bus Station. The journey, including transfers, takes approximately 6h 15m.
No, there is no direct train from Berlin to Piła. However, there are services departing from S Ostbahnhof and arriving at Pila Glowna via Rzepin and Poznan Glowny. The journey, including transfers, takes approximately 4h 59m.
The distance between Berlin and Piła is 352 km. The road distance is 256.5 km.
The best way to get from Berlin to Piła without a car is to train which takes 4h 59m and costs 220 zł - 490 zł.
It takes approximately 4h 59m to get from Berlin to Piła, including transfers.
Berlin to Piła bus services, operated by FlixBus, depart from Berlin Alexanderplatz station.
Berlin to Piła train services, operated by Deutsche Bahn Intercity (DB IC), depart from S Ostbahnhof station.
The best way to get from Berlin to Piła is to train which takes 4h 59m and costs 220 zł - 490 zł. Alternatively, you can bus via Szczecin, which costs 120 zł - 200 zł and takes 6h 15m.
What companies run services between Berlin, Germany and Piła, Poland?
You can take a train from S Ostbahnhof to Pila Glowna via Rzepin and Poznan Glowny in around 4h 59m. Alternatively, you can take a bus from Berlin Alexanderplatz to Pila, Centrum Przesiadkowe via Szczecin, Bus Station in around 6h 15m.
- Phone
- +49 30 311 682904
- Website
- bahn.de
Train from S Ostbahnhof to Rzepin
- Ave. Duration
- 1h 6m
- Frequency
- Hourly
- Estimated price
- zł 80–190
- Website
- https://int.bahn.de/en
- Phone
- +48 22 322 22 22
- infokraj@intercity.pl
- Website
- intercity.pl
Train from Rzepin to Poznan Glowny
- Ave. Duration
- 1h 18m
- Frequency
- Every 4 hours
- Estimated price
- zł 120–190
- Website
- https://www.intercity.pl/en/
Train from Poznan Glowny to Pila Glowna
- Ave. Duration
- 1h 6m
- Frequency
- Every 4 hours
- Estimated price
- zł 100–110
- Website
- https://www.intercity.pl/en/
Train from Szczecin Glowny to Pila Glowna
- Ave. Duration
- 3h 3m
- Frequency
- Once daily
- Estimated price
- zł 40–75
- Website
- https://www.intercity.pl/en/
- 2nd Class
- zł 40–55
- 1st Class
- zł 55–75
Train from Poznan Glowny to Pila Glowna
- Ave. Duration
- 1h 39m
- Frequency
- Every 2 hours
- Schedules at
- koleje-wielkopolskie.com.pl
- Phone
- +48 22 474 00 44
- bilety@polregio.pl
- Website
- polregio.pl
Train from Poznan Glowny to Pila Glowna
- Ave. Duration
- 1h 42m
- Frequency
- 5 times a day
- Estimated price
- zł 20–28
- Website
- https://polregio.pl/pl/
Train from Szczecin Glowny to Pila Glowna
- Ave. Duration
- 2h 52m
- Frequency
- 4 times a day
- Estimated price
- zł 30–45
- Website
- https://polregio.pl/pl/
- Phone
- +49 30 300 137 300
- service@flixbus.com
- Website
- flixbus.fr
Bus from Berlin Alexanderplatz to Szczecin, Bus Station
- Ave. Duration
- 2h 5m
- Frequency
- Every 2 hours
- Estimated price
- zł 55–100
- Website
- https://www.flixbus.co.uk
Bus from Szczecin, Bus Station to Pila, Centrum Przesiadkowe
- Ave. Duration
- 3h 10m
- Frequency
- 5 times a week
- Estimated price
- zł 65–95
- Website
- https://www.flixbus.co.uk
- Phone
- +48 801 22 33 44
- bilety@sindbad.pl
- Website
- sindbad.pl
Bus from BERLIN, ZOB am Funkturm to SŁUBICE, Port Świecko, Świecko 39
- Ave. Duration
- 2h 5m
- Frequency
- Twice daily
- Estimated price
- zł 220–270
- Website
- https://www.sindbad.pl/en/home
Bus from SŁUBICE, Port Świecko, Świecko 39 to PIŁA, Centrum Przesiadkowe, ul. Zygmunta Starego,stan.9
- Ave. Duration
- 3h 5m
- Frequency
- Once daily
- Estimated price
- zł 230–280
- Website
- https://www.sindbad.pl/en/home
Want to know more about travelling around Poland
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Want to know more about Flixbus?
Read the travel guide
Heading to Europe? Read this before you buy a Eurail Pass
Read the travel guide
More Questions & Answers
Berlin to Piła bus services, operated by FlixBus, arrive at Szczecin, Bus Station.
Berlin to Piła train services, operated by Deutsche Bahn Intercity (DB IC), arrive at Rzepin station.
Yes, the driving distance between Berlin to Piła is 256 km. It takes approximately 4h 2m to drive from Berlin to Piła.
Book your Berlin to Piła train tickets online with Omio.
Book your Berlin to Piła bus tickets online with Omio and FlixBus.
There are 129+ hotels available in Piła.




















